Output 64684ddcb156eabd904be118c2242fda170fe433ffbe5d8ec69ce9494ff9b26d:0

value
99000
script pubkey
OP_0 OP_PUSHBYTES_20 ac1255746601f2ee9b4bb5b36289449b073e97c5
address
bc1q4sf92arxq8ewax6tkkek9z2ynvrna979vf55s8
transaction
64684ddcb156eabd904be118c2242fda170fe433ffbe5d8ec69ce9494ff9b26d
confirmations
30875
spent
true